How to Apply
- Clean the surface thoroughly and allow it to dry completely.
- Measure and cut the strip to the required length.
- Peel off the protective backing and press the strip firmly along the gap.
- Hold in place for 10–15 seconds for maximum adhesion.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What surfaces does the self-adhesive door and window sealing strip stick to?
A: The sealing strip adheres to most smooth, clean, and dry surfaces including wood, aluminum, uPVC, and painted metal door and window frames. For best results, wipe the surface with a clean cloth before application and allow it to dry fully before pressing the strip into place.
